Denise DeBaun, President and CEO of Sustainable Youth® Technologies, has leveraged her expertise as an entrepreneur and brand development specialist to create a global green beauty and wellness brand based on organic, natural science. Denise is responsible for organizing an elite team of scientists and industry experts in the development, marketing and distribution of all Sustainable Youth® products. Under her direction, Sustainable Youth® has created the breakthrough organic compound Alasta® and formulated a range of clinically proven cpsmecutical and nutraceutical treatments that provide more youthful-looking, healthy skin from the inside out.

Her leadership role with Sustainable Youth® Technologies allows her to combine her passion for organic and sustainable practices with a visionary’s perspective on the future of the beauty industry. As a lifelong proponent of the green movement and student of more holistic Eastern practices and philosophies, Denise is leading the charge to harness the power of natural ingredients and sustainable practices to redefine green beauty for the next generation.

As a sought-after industry expert , prior to her role with Sustainable Youth® Technologies, Denise was founder of a successful business development and consulting agency, and she has been a senior-level executive responsible for some of the most successful brand launches in the industry. The most notable include Obsession and Eternity fragrances for Calvin Klein, Ralph Lauren fragrances, Oscar de la Renta, Geoffrey Beene, and the private label brands for Victoria’s Secret, Intimate Brands/Bath & Body Works, Abercrombie & Fitch and Henri Bendel., consumer and trade publications on current trends. 

In addition to a B.A. in Business Education from the School of Health, Nursing, Education and Arts from New York University, Denise is a graduate of the Michael Scholes School of Aromatherapy.
